The doors on my 67 912 fit well from a panel gap perspective however, when viewed from behind the top half of the door surrounding the glass doesnt appear to sit snuggly up against the seal almost looking like you could put your fingers between the shinny metal frame and rubber. The bottom half of the door sits snuggly. Is it possible to adjust the top of the door inwards, if so how.

I am just doing this job in order to get the glass working in the frames better.
I think I am right in saying that you can adjust the top frame by loosening the (my car had) five bolts which hold the frame in place. There is then a lot of movement. You will have to take down the door cards, bins, handles etc in order to gain access to the middle frame bolt attachment. There are a series of bolts two front of door upper one by the middle bat quarter light, lower middle center, (accessable through the speaker hole) and then lower door below the door lock.
On adjustment there is a need to ensure the windows are moving up and down easily. There is a tightening sequence as well starting at the lock end. There is a good picture and description in a Haynes Manual in the bodywork suppliment.
Its not hard but it is time consuming and it helps to have another pair of hands.
